19 Stocks Hiked Dividends Last Week

Stocks with dividend hikes from last week originally published at “long-term-investments.blogspot.com”. 19 companies increased its dividend payments last week and additional 7 other vehicles like funds boosted dividends to new levels.

The retailer TJX Companies is a popular name on the list. The company announced to raise dividends by 26.1 percent. Another big player is the financial services group PNC who operates money center banks within the states. PNC Financial Services announced to raise its dividends by 10 percent.  

In total, 26 stocks and fund vehicles increased its dividend payments last week of which six are High-Yields and 10 are currently recommended to buy. The average dividend growth amounts to 16.83 percent.

14 Stocks And 6 Funds Hiked Dividends Last Week

Stocks with dividend hikes from last week originally published at “long-term-investments.blogspot.com”. 

Last week was an additional week where 20 stocks announced to raise dividends. MFA Financial, is on the list with a 10 percent hike. Other big companies are Cisco, the company which handles traffic on the internet. Cisco raised its dividends by 21.4 percent and is definitely my top pick from the results. Five stocks are debt-free and additional five have a low debt ratio.

In total, 20 funds and stocks increased its dividend payments last week of which five are high-yields and 10 are recommended to buy. The average dividend growth amounts to 71.91 percent.

The Best Dividend Stock Buys Of Arnold Van Den Berg - Century Management Advisers

Arnold Van Den Berg Fund Investing Strategies By Dividend Yield – Stock Capital, Investment. Here is a current update of Arnold Van Den Berg’s best dividend stock buys. Last quarter, he bought twenty stocks of which nine have a positive dividend yield. None of his recent buys has a yield over three percent. The best stocks are mixed from the consumer, services, industrial and technology sector.
